World Bipolar Day

March 30, 2024

World Bipolar Day, observed annually on March 30th, is dedicated to raising awareness about bipolar disorders and reducing the stigma associated with them. This global initiative aims to promote understanding, education, and support for individuals affected by bipolar disorder. Through various events, educational campaigns, and community outreach, World Bipolar Day fosters open conversations, emphasises the significance of early diagnosis and treatment, and encourages individuals to share their experiences. The day serves as a platform to advocate for mental health resources, research, and policies that contribute to a more compassionate and informed approach to bipolar disorders on a global scale.
